The World in His Arms

This is not the title of an upcoming James Bond movie, but a movie starring Gregory Peck as a sea captain in the mid-19th century Pacific.

While in San Francisco, he meets a Russian countess disguised as a prostitute in order to hide out from her arranged fiancee.

Before they can become wed, however, the fiancee kidnaps the countess. Peck and his rival of the seas, played by Anthony Quinn, decide to rescue her. They race to Alaska with the winner getting the other's ship and crew to rescue the countess.
